Triple-Layer Protection Attached Faraday CapSeals the Cinch The cinch closure is the most vulnerable point of any sack-style Faraday enclosure. The attached Faraday cap folds over and covers the entire cinch area after sealing. Combined with the dual-cinch drawstring, this creates three layers of signal protection at the closure point, ensuring no RF leakage even in high-signal-strength environments. How to Use Field Deployment Guide The Faraday Sack is designed for rapid deployment. Follow these steps to ensure complete RF signal isolation. 01 Power Off or Disable Wireless (If Possible) Power down the device or disable wireless radios before insertion if the situation allows. In active seizure scenarios, insert immediately to cut off remote access. 02 Open and Insert Fully open the cinch drawstring and insert the drone or device. Remove propellers if needed to reduce bulk. 03 Cinch and Secure Pull the drawstring firmly closed. A loose seal will allow signal leakage. Ensure no part of the device protrudes outside the enclosure. 04 Cover with the Faraday Cap Fold the attached Faraday cap over the cinch area to add the third layer of signal protection. 05 Verify and Transport Confirm isolation with a signal detection app. Keep sealed during transport and document chain of custody for forensic evidence. TitanRF Faraday Fabric contains copper and nickel. It is conductive and flammable. Keep away from outlets, plugs, cables, and any electrical sources. Wear gloves when handling if your skin is sensitive to nickel or copper. Questions? Contact our team for guidance. Built to Any Size One Standard Size.Infinite Custom Options.
